Explain formation of a potential barrier in a p-n junction
Formation of Potential Barrier in a P-N junction: The two kinds of extrinsic semiconductors p-type and n-type are shown in fig. (a). P-type semiconductor is having negative acceptor ions and positively charged holes. While the n-type semiconductor is having positive donor ions and negatively charged electrons.
